What is Techno Music?

Techno music is a type of electronic dance music that originated in Detroit, Michigan in the United States in the late 1980s. The first Detroit techno artists were Juan Atkins, Derrick May, and Kevin Saunderson, who were later joined by Jeff Mills and Steve Stacey. Techno music is typically characterized by a strong 4/4 beat, with a driving bassline and synthesizer melodies.

Characteristics of Techno Music

Techno is a type of electronic dance music that originated in the Detroit area in the 1980s. The first techno tracks were produced by artists such as Juan Atkins, Kevin Saunderson, and Derrick May, who were influenced by the electronic music of Kraftwerk and Giorgio Moroder. Techno is characterized by a repetitive four-on-the-floor beat, often accompanied by synthesizers and drum machines. The style evolved in the 1990s with the help of producers such as Richie Hawtin and Jeff Mills, who introduced more complex rhythms and experimental sound processing techniques. Techno remains popular today, with many subgenres such as minimal techno, tech house, and hard techno.
